Tex. Gov't Code § 2155.504

USE OF SCHEDULE BY GOVERNMENTAL ENTITIES

Known as the State Purchasing and General Services Act

The act spans §§ 2151.001 to 2177.010 (567 sections).

Added by Acts 2001, 77th Leg., ch. 1422, Sec. 2.01, eff

(a) Except as provided by this subsection, a state agency or local government may purchase goods or services directly from a vendor under a contract listed on a schedule developed under this subchapter. A state agency or local government contracting for the purchase of an automated information system under a contract listed on a schedule developed under this subchapter shall comply with Section 2157.068(e-1). A purchase authorized by this section satisfies any requirement of state law relating to competitive bids or proposals.

(b) The price listed for a good or service under a multiple award contract is a maximum price. An agency or local government may negotiate a lower price for goods or services under a contract listed on a schedule developed under this subchapter.
